Signed-off-by: main <magic_rb@redalder.org>
This commit is contained in:
main 2022-09-22 15:32:03 +02:00
parent 9245fcb024
commit 417c3dee36
No known key found for this signature in database
GPG key ID: 08D5287CC5DDCA0E

View file

@ -21,17 +21,18 @@ nglib.makeSystem {
-p 9898 \ -p 9898 \
-o @magic_rb:matrix.redalder.org \ -o @magic_rb:matrix.redalder.org \
''; '';
homeserverURI = "https://matrix.redalder.org/";
in in
pkgs.writeShellScript "heisenbridge" pkgs.writeShellScript "heisenbridge"
'' ''
REGISTRATION_FILE="/var/lib/registrations/heisenbridge.yaml" REGISTRATION_FILE="/var/lib/registrations/heisenbridge.yaml"
[ -e "$REGISTRATION_FILE" ] || \ [ -e "$REGISTRATION_FILE" ] || \
${pkgs.heisenbridge}/bin/heisenbridge \ ${pkgs.heisenbridge}/bin/heisenbridge '${homeserverURI}' \
-c "$REGISTRATION_FILE" \ -c "$REGISTRATION_FILE" \
${config} \ ${config} \
--generate --generate
${pkgs.heisenbridge}/bin/heisenbridge \ ${pkgs.heisenbridge}/bin/heisenbridge '${homeserverURI}' \
-c "$REGISTRATION_FILE" \ -c "$REGISTRATION_FILE" \
${config} ${config}
''; '';